JCN Charger Boys End Season with Tough First Round Lost at State
By Mike Smith

For the second straight year the Jefferson County North Charger boys made the State tournament in Class 2A and were looking to make it out of the state tournament first round this year, unlike last year and the time at state before that back in 1999. The Chargers as the six seed at 17-6 took on the 20-3, third seeded Republic County and ran into a tough opponent and despite leading at the half the Chargers ended their season with 78-68 loss.

The game started off with a flurry as both teams poured in 20 points in the first quarter, then the Chargers pushed out to a one-point lead at halftime, 36-35, with JCN and Republic County accounting for 11 three-pointers together.

Coming out of the half Republic County used a 17-9 third quarter and gained the lead headed into the fourth quarter and wouldn't give it up, moving to the 78-68 win.

In the loss the Chargers were lead by four players in double figures with Luke Pyle leading the way with 19 points. Cory Noll, Jacob GrandPre and Shawn Lane each added double digits with 17, 14 and 12 points.

JCN ends their year with a 17-7 record with the loss in the first round at state, after making the state tournament for the second straight year.
